Function of the figure-eight optical cable reel

A figure-eight optical cable reel is used to store, transport, and deploy fiber optic cables while preventing twisting, kinking, and damage during installation.Core FunctionThe primary function of a fiber optic cable reel is to securely store and manage fiber optic cables, which are delicate and sensitive to bending or tension that could disrupt light signal transmission . The reel allows for controlled unwinding and spooling, ensuring that the cable can be deployed smoothly over long distances without tangling or damage .Purpose of the Figure-Eight ConfigurationWhen laying out fiber optic cable, especially for long overhead or underground runs, the cable is often arranged in a figure-eight pattern on the ground before pulling . This configuration serves several purposes:Prevents twisting: The half-twist on one side of the "8" is counteracted on the other side, eliminating torsion in the cable that could damage fibers .Reduces kinks and bends: The figure-eight loop distributes the cable evenly, preventing sharp bends that could impair signal transmission .Facilitates midspan pulls: For very long runs, the figure-eight method allows technicians to pull cable from a midpoint to both ends efficiently, maintaining proper tension and alignment .Additional BenefitsProtects cable integrity: By combining the reel with the figure-eight layout, installers minimize stress on the optical fibers, preserving their high-speed data transmission capabilities .Streamlines installation: The reel and figure-eight technique make it easier to handle long cable lengths, whether for aerial deployments, urban pole-to-home drops, or rural broadband projects .Supports self-supporting cables: Figure-8 fiber optic cables often include an integrated messenger wire, allowing them to span long distances without additional support hardware, and the reel helps manage this structure during deployment . In summary, the figure-eight optical cable reel is an essential tool in fiber optic installations, combining safe storage, efficient deployment, and protection against twisting or kinking, which is critical for maintaining the performance and longevity of fiber optic networks .
